Ontario Youth Apprenticehsip Program
(OYAP) |
- Employers can have High School students for co-op placements while student is still in school
- Student can be registered as an apprentice
- OYAP students are exempt from ratio while on placement for co-op hours

Summer Job Service
through Employment
Ontario |
- Employers can keep High School, College or University students employed through the summer
- Employers receive a $2.00 per hour wage subsidy if they qualify for the summer job program
|
$1280.00 potential |

| Apprenticeship Training Tax Credit |
- Employer can apply for this on their taxes based on the first 48 months of the
apprenticeship wages. Has a potential of $10,000.00 / year for the first 4 years
|
Potentially $40000.00 per apprentice |
|
Apprenticeship Employer Signing Bonus |
- Employer hires eligible employee
- Employer receives first installment after apprentice is registered with MTCU and the other installment 6 months later ($1000.00 each)
|
$2000.00 |
|
Apprenticeship Job Creation Tax Credit |
- Employers are eligible for a non-refundable tax credit up to $2000 per year for the first two years of apprenticeship (Red Seal Trades only)
|
$4000 potential |
|
Tradesperson Tool deduction |
- If employer is also a tradesperson,. they are eligible write off half of their yearly tool budget to a maximum of $1000
|
$500.00 yearly |
|
Co-operative education tax credit |
- A refundable tax credit offered to employers operating unincorporated businesses who hire enrolled in a recognized Ontario college or University co-operative education program
|
$3000.00 max. per student per work term |
|
Employer Completion
Bonus
|
- An apprentice completes an apprenticeship program be receives C of A and where
applicable, C of Q |
$1000.00 |
